Trickery. Deceit. Magic. In Orson Welles' free-from documentary "F For Fake," the legendary filmmaker (and self-describes charlatan) gleefully engages the central preoccupation of his career - the tenuous line between truth and illusion, art and lies. Beginning with portraits of world-renowned art forger Elmyr de Hory and his equally devious biographer, Clifford Irving, Welles goes on a dizzying cinematic journey that simultaneously exposes and revels in fakery and fakers of all stripes - not the least of which is Welles himself. Charming and inventive, "F For Fake" is an inspired prank and a searching examination of the essential duplicity of cinema.
